Economic effectiveness of investment in bioenergetic culture growing in the zones of forest of Ukraine

Abstract

Introduction. One of the most promising areas of renewable energy development is the use of biomass energy. It contributes to the economy of traditional fuels and does not increase the global greenhouse effect. However, insufficient economic efficiency of obtaining energy from biomass under the current conditions necessitates the state's "paternalism" to the bioenergy industry. Purpose. The article aims to carry out an economic assessment of the effectiveness of investing in the cultivation of highly productive energy crops (giant miscanthus and energy willow) using modern technologies under the conditions of the Ukrainian forest-steppe. Method. The research was conducted during 2012-2016 on the basis of experimental energy plantations in Ternopil, Volyn and Kyiv oblasts. The assessment of the effectiveness of investment in bioenergy crops is based on a set of criteria: net discounted profit (NPV), investment profitability index (PI), internal rate of return (IRR), discounted payback period (DPP). Results. It has been established that on plantations of willow, the volume of dry biomass on average over the five-year period of research amounted to 27,3 t · ha-1, and to the miscanthus - 25,3 t · ha-1. Accordingly, the energy output per unit area was somewhat higher in energy willow (573.3 GJ · ha-1 versus 516.2 GJ · ha-1). Willow and miscanthus are characterized by high-energy coefficients compared with other bioenergy crops, which can reach values 54.3 and 55. It indicates the significant energy efficiency of investing in the cultivation of these crops. The analysis of the sensitivity of bioenergy projects has found out that the most significant NPV investment in the plantation of the miscanthus can be influenced by the volatility of the productivity of the crop, the price of biofuels and planting material, and for the willow plantation - fluctuations in the yield of biomass, its price and discount rate. The estimation of the investment efficiency in the bio-energy plantations of the miscanthus and willows has revealed the need to work out state programs of financial support for the creation of plantations of bioenergy crops and legislative mechanisms for their implementation.
